Default heating advice please

this is for my little royal and need heating advice please
hes currently in a faunarium which is inside a viv with heatmat under 1 end (of the faunarium)

got him a new viv (2second hand) which is 18"Wx18"Hx15"D and wondering about best way to heat it for a royal

id guess its too small for a ceramic so guess its a heatmat but how big and where?
inside? outside? bottom?side? will have a matstat available from the 3ft viv to use. dont currently have a mat that will fit inside on bottom and only about 1/3 of viv size but can order
where ever it goes should i cover it with some sort of tile? have concerns of burning snake and not heating viv sufficently
if best way is to use a mat under one end of viv then i could use one of my larger mats maybe? will heat get through wood well enough?

The heat mat should be controlled by the mat stat you have, you can then place it in the viv (mat size should be 1/3 of the base of the viv). You can then either place a ceramic tile over the mat or build a false floor using polycarbonate sheet and some sort of beading to lift the shhet off the mat by a few mm, this will protect your snake from the mat it also makes the viv easy to clean.
